“Bully For You”

In "Bully For You," Bugs Bunny finds himself unexpectedly thrust into the spotlight—literally—when a shrewd merchandiser exploits his likeness to the famed bullfighter Senor Pedro Bunny, dragging him (and Porky) into the wilds of Bullexico. Forced into the bull ring against his will, Bugs must think fast to outwit an angry matador and his flamboyant fanfare, all while keeping his cool and his signature wit intact. Art by Tom McKimson brings the zany spectacle to life, with Ralph Heimdahl’s dynamic cover capturing the chaos in bold, expressive lines.

Bugs, with Porky in tow, is lured to Bullexico by an unscrupulous merchandiser who wants to capitalize on Bugs' resemblance to the great bullfighter Senor Pedro Bunny. Bugs refuses to go along with the scheme, but is still forced into the bull ring by an angry Pedro.
